+!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!WARNING!!!!!!!!
+The zero page is a kernel internal data structure, not a stable ABI. It might change
+without warning and the kernel has no way to detect old version of it.
+If you're writing some external code like a boot loader you should only use
+the stable versioned real mode boot protocol described in boot.txt. Otherwise the kernel
+might break you at any time.
+!!!!!!!!!!!!!WARNING!!!!!!!!!!!
